DISCUSSION
The City is processing an application for annexation of approximately 70 acres located at the northeast corner of Yosemite Avenue and Gardner Road (Attachment 1). Dudek Consulting has been contracted to prepare the Environmental Impact Report (EIR) for this project. The project applicants, Cliff Caton and University Village Merced, LLC, have modified the project since the initial application which has resulted in the need to modify the work done on the EIR. In order to cover the cost of the additional work, the Professional Services Contract with Dudek needs to be modified. The proposed First Amendment to the Professional Services Agreement with Dudek Consulting would add an additional $7,044 to the original contract amount of $193,286. The First Amendment to this contract is provided at Attachment 2 with the additional scope of work provided at Exhibit 1 of the First Amendment.
The developer is required to pay the costs associated with the Environmental Review. As such, the Deposit and Reimbursement Agreement entered into by University Village Merced, LLC, needs to be amended to reflect the additional costs in order for the City to be reimbursed. The First Amendment to the Deposit and Reimbursement Agreement with University Village Merced, LLC, agreeing to pay the addition $7,044 is provided at Attachment 3.
IMPACT ON CITY RESOURCES
The cost of the Environmental Impact Report will be completely reimbursed to the City by the developers. Actions to appropriate the revenue to the corresponding Accounts in the Development Services Department budget are included in the recommendation.
